For an upscale cruise line, the wines are very downscale!:(:(
Very disappointing experience over the last 2 years with Celebrity and wines. The same wine that I drank 2 years ago at $15.00 a glass ( I was willing to pay $2.00 overage for each glass) is now $22.00 a glass. The price of the same bottle at home has not changed in those 2 years. So, now if I drink 4 glass at $22.00 each and pay the overage of $9.00 for each glass, I just purchased the bottle at a 50% premium over retail cost and the drink package was worthless!
Solution...BYOW...Bring your own wine!:D:D = ZERO revenue for Celebrity!

We were just on Equinox in December and we were on Connie in February of 2016.
The places you mention are between 3/4 of a mile to a mile from the ship. If walking is an issue for you, Mardi Gras will not be your cup of tea...very hard to get transportation to the events and almost IMPOSSIBLE to get transportation back, once the event is finished. If you go to New Orleans at other times, getting transportation is MUCH easier. :):)
